Scope: restoring the scheduler account that dispatches batch email digests. Trigger: account lockout blocks all digest runs; no automatic failover exists. Procedure: confirm lockout in the audit trail, verify no active compromise indicators, then initiate restore from the sealed operator vault. The vault enforces two-person approval; the second approver must witness entry. Restoration requires the standing recovery passphrase held in escrow for this runbook. For reviewer verification purposes, that passphrase is recorded immediately below.

unlock words, hahip-yagef: zorok-novmir-zorix-silax

Quarterly Planning Note — Warranty Cost Overrun

Warranty claims on the Strovane HX heater line ran 34% over forecast this quarter, driven mainly by the faulty valve assemblies from the Mersham batch. Engineering has confirmed a fix for units shipping from next month, and a goodwill replacement scheme is being drafted. Sales leads should avoid firm commitments on extended warranty terms until the revised cost model lands. Budget adjustments will absorb most of the overrun, but pricing on the HX line may shift. This connects to the following.

board note of hafog-kafop: Only 50 of the 505 pilot accounts renewed Eliys, so a churn review is set for April 7. Fravanox Partners is in early talks to buy Tamvanix Logistics for about $273.9 million.

Marketing spend will be reduced by 15% effective the start of next quarter, concentrated in display advertising and the Solmere sponsorship programme. Brand and product-launch budgets for the Quillon range are protected. Finance should rebase the quarterly forecast accordingly and adjust accrual schedules before the close. Variance reporting will move to a fortnightly cadence during the transition. Reallocation of the released funds has been agreed at executive level, and the confidential plan is set out immediately below.

internal memo for hahif-hahaf: Headcount on the Zorwyn team goes from 9 to 100 by the end of October. Gross margin on Zorwyn came in at 5 percent against a plan of 10 percent.